When to Plant Radish in Anne Arundel County, MD
Radishes are one of the fastest-growing vegetables, with some varieties ready in under a month. They come in round, elongated, and large winter types.
Anne Arundel County, Maryland is in USDA Zone 7a. The average last spring frost is April 3 and the first fall frost is November 3, giving you a growing season of approximately 214 days.
At an elevation of 435 feet, Anne Arundel County receives approximately 41 inches of rainfall annually with predominantly silt loam soil. Summer highs average 93ยฐF, providing good warmth for Radish during the growing season.

Radish Planting Timeline โ Anne Arundel County, MD
Radish Planting Calendar
| Activity | When | Date Range |
|---|---|---|
| Direct Sow | March 20 | Mar 20 โ Apr 10 |
| Fall Sowing | August 25 | Aug 25 โ Sep 8 |
| Harvest | April 17 | Apr 17 โ May 8 |
Plant 0.5" deep ยท 2" apart ยท Rows 6" apart

Growing Tips for Anne Arundel County
Direct sow every 1-2 weeks for continuous harvest. Do not transplant. Harvest spring radishes promptly to prevent them from becoming pithy and hot.
